A podcast designed and made to have unfiltered conversations, exciting takes, and conversations about the automotive dealership sector experience, communication, and processes. We look for people in the street and do our best not to get the talking heads from the executive level so we can hear what is going on and how the everyday person sees things.

  3. Paying it Forward and Passing the Torch of a Winning Attitude and Spirit

    JUN 4

    Paying it Forward and Passing the Torch of a Winning Attitude and Spirit

    Welcome back to another episode of Street Smarts, powered by SmartWolf Consulting, where we dive deep into the mindset, strategies, and execution that drive success—not just in the automotive world, but in every high-performance arena. Today, we’re shifting gears—literally—into the world of motorsports, where strategy, preparation, and execution separate the good from the great. Joining us is a man who knows exactly what it takes to build a winning team, both on and off the track. Scott Allen, co-owner of Scott Allen Racing, is dedicated to giving rising motorsport stars the opportunity to compete in top-tier equipment, chase checkered flags, and elevate their brand—while also growing the legacy of Scott Allen Racing itself. Scott has been a crew member on multiple successful teams, including working with Tommy Baldwin Racing in the ultra-competitive Tour-Type Modifieds. His passion for the next generation of racers is clear in the talent he’s bringing to the track—drivers like Caleb Heady, a former SMART Modified Tour champion, Ameyla Gonzalez, a rising star in the Outlaw division at Stafford Motor Speedway, and Reagan Parent, a Legends Cars winner with deep racing roots, all driving the iconic No. 7NY. And speaking of the 7NY, it’s more than just a number—it’s a tribute to the legendary "Tiger" Tom Baldwin, a Modified champion whose legacy continues through his son, Tommy Baldwin Jr., and teams like Scott’s, carrying the torch forward.
